and his officers attended the New Year Day military review held by the National Government..

Ater staying here six days, the Jayn w he returning to Sourabaya. Rear-Admiral Broecke- Hoekstra will leave the vessel at Batavia to resume his command of the Naval Department of tho Dutch East Indies.

NANKING EXCITED.

W

OVER DISMISSAL OF GENERAL.

Was

Nanking, Jan. 8. Considerable, excitement created here yesterday, when Marshal Chiang Kai-shek, issued the edict dismissing General Chien Ta-chun, who has beon, re- garded as one of his most loyal subordinates:

General Chlen, who has latterly been commanding the Third National Division, was formerly Commander of the Shanghai Garrí. son and was only recently appoint. ed by Marshal Chiang Kai-shek to be the Commander of a campaign to suppress bandits in cities on the south bank of the Yangtze River. The edict appoints the assistant of General Ohlen, Chan Shing-ki, to all the vacancy, and has order- ed General Chien's troops to re- main at Soochow

It is understood that the Govern- ment will shortly order the dis- solution of the headquarters of the bandit suppression campaign under the dismissed leader.
